
Clans will have player caps of 150 members and will work together to grind achievements, and participate in server-wide PvP faction conflicts. Warbands allow players to join forces with up to seven other players (maximum eight) to tackle targeted objectives as a team. Players will be able to choose from six of Diablo’s iconic classes including Barbarian, Crusader, Demon Hunter, Monk, Necromancer, and Wizard, while hunting for legendary gear and Set Items complete with affixes and bonuses allowing players to completely switch up any classes play style.ĭiablo Immortal is heavily weighted towards social elements with Warbands and Clans available to participate in from either side of the Shadows or Immortals factions. The game has players travelling through eight unique zones to gather the shards of the shattered Worldstone before the Lieutenant of Diable himself, Skarn, gets to them first.
